串口服务器可编程接口是什么

worktile 其他 42

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    串口服务器可编程接口是一种用于通过网络与串口设备进行通信的接口。它提供了一组编程接口,允许开发人员通过网络发送和接收数据,控制和监控串口设备。

    首先,串口服务器可编程接口提供了一组用于连接和管理串口设备的函数。开发人员可以使用这些函数来建立与串口服务器的连接,并设置串口设备的参数,例如波特率、数据位、停止位和校验位。

    其次,串口服务器可编程接口还提供了函数来发送和接收数据。开发人员可以使用这些函数来向串口设备发送数据,或从串口设备接收数据。可以通过设置超时参数来控制函数的等待时间,以适应不同的通信需求。

    除了基本的连接和数据传输功能,串口服务器可编程接口还支持一些高级功能。例如,开发人员可以使用接口提供的函数来设置流控制方式,如硬件流控制和软件流控制。还可以通过接口提供的函数来控制串口设备的状态,如打开和关闭串口设备、清除串口缓冲区等。

    总结起来,串口服务器可编程接口提供了一组丰富的函数,使开发人员能够方便地通过网络与串口设备进行通信。通过使用这些接口,可以实现对串口设备的远程控制和监控,拓展了串口设备的应用范围。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    串口服务器可编程接口是一种用于控制和管理串口服务器的软件接口。它允许开发人员通过编程来访问和操作串口服务器的功能和设置,以实现自定义的应用程序和功能。

    以下是串口服务器可编程接口的一些常见功能和操作:

    1. 设备连接和配置:通过编程接口,开发人员可以连接到串口服务器并配置其参数,如串口类型、波特率、数据位、停止位、校验位等。这使得开发人员可以根据实际需求灵活地设置串口服务器的参数。

    2. 数据传输:使用编程接口,开发人员可以在串口服务器和远程设备之间进行双向数据传输。他们可以发送和接收数据,包括文本、二进制数据或任何其他类型的数据。这为开发各种应用程序和解决方案提供了便利。

    3. 设备控制和操作:通过编程接口,开发人员可以控制和操作连接到串口服务器的远程设备。他们可以发送特定的控制命令和指令,例如打开或关闭设备、更改设备模式或参数、执行特定功能等。这使得开发人员可以直接与远程设备进行交互并管理其状态和行为。

    4. 事件处理:串口服务器可编程接口通常提供事件处理功能,开发人员可以注册事件处理程序来处理特定的事件和通知。例如,当接收到数据、连接状态变化、错误发生等事件时,开发人员可以编写代码来响应这些事件,并进行适当的处理和操作。

    5. 安全和权限控制:编程接口通常还提供安全和权限控制功能,用于保护串口服务器和连接的设备。开发人员可以通过编程接口设置访问权限、用户身份验证和加密通信等功能,以确保只有授权用户可以访问和控制串口服务器。

    通过串口服务器可编程接口,开发人员可以实现各种自定义的应用程序和解决方案,例如远程设备管理、物联网应用、工业自动化、远程监控等。编程接口使开发人员能够更方便地使用串口服务器的功能,提高开发效率,并满足不同应用的需求。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    串口服务器可编程接口是指通过编程方式使用串口服务器的接口。通过该接口,可以实现与串口服务器的交互和控制,包括发送数据到串口服务器、接收从串口服务器发送的数据,以及配置串口服务器的参数等。

    串口服务器可编程接口一般使用一种串口通信协议(例如RS-232或RS-485)进行数据传输。通过该接口,可以通过计算机或其他设备与串口服务器进行通信。下面将从方法和操作流程两个方面来介绍串口服务器的可编程接口。

    方法:

    1. 创建串口服务器对象:首先需要创建一个串口服务器对象,即实例化一个串口服务器类。通过指定串口服务器的IP地址和端口号等参数,创建一个与串口服务器连接的对象。

    2. 配置串口服务器参数:通过调用相应的方法,可以配置串口服务器的参数,包括波特率、数据位、停止位、校验位等。可以根据实际需求进行设置,以实现对串口服务器的控制。

    3. 打开串口连接:通过调用打开串口的方法,可以建立与串口服务器的连接。可以设置超时时间等参数,以便在一定时间内连接成功并返回结果。

    4. 发送数据:通过调用发送数据的方法,可以将数据发送到串口服务器。可以发送单个字节、字符串或二进制数据等。可以根据实际需求进行调用,以实现对串口服务器的控制。

    5. 接收数据:通过调用接收数据的方法,可以从串口服务器接收数据。可以设置缓冲区大小和超时时间等参数,以便成功接收数据并返回结果。

    6. 关闭串口连接:通过调用关闭串口连接的方法,可以断开与串口服务器的连接。可以释放资源,并确保与串口服务器的连接正确关闭。

    操作流程:

    1. 创建串口服务器对象:通过指定串口服务器的IP地址和端口号等参数,创建一个与串口服务器连接的对象。

    2. 配置串口服务器参数:根据实际需求,调用配置串口服务器参数的方法,设置波特率、数据位、停止位、校验位等参数。

    3. 打开串口连接:调用打开串口连接的方法,建立与串口服务器的连接。可以设置超时时间等参数,等待连接成功返回结果。

    4. 发送数据:调用发送数据的方法,将数据发送到串口服务器。可以发送单个字节、字符串或二进制数据等。

    5. 接收数据:调用接收数据的方法,从串口服务器接收数据。可以设置缓冲区大小和超时时间等参数,等待成功接收数据并返回结果。

    6. 关闭串口连接:调用关闭串口连接的方法,断开与串口服务器的连接。释放资源,并确保连接正确关闭。

    通过以上方法和操作流程,可以实现对串口服务器的编程控制。可以发送和接收数据,以及配置和管理串口服务器的参数,满足不同应用场景的需求。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部